I am stuck at two different things on Qlik Sense
1. I have to calculate stock rolling over 45 days from maximum date
Count({<Date={'>=$(vRolling45)<=$(vMaxim)'}>} Distinct SerialNo) // This is done.
where vMaxim =Date((Max(Date)),'DD-MM-YYYY')
vRolling45=Date((Max(Date)-45),'DD-MM-YYYY')
but now I have to calculate rolling over 45 days from maximum date -1
For now i have created another variable
vMaxim_1 =Date((Max(Date)-1),'DD-MM-YYYY')
vRolling45_1=Date((Max(Date)-46),'DD-MM-YYYY')
expression changed to this:
Count({<Date={'>=$(vRolling45_1)<=$(vMaxim_1)'}>} Distinct SerialNo)
Similarly,
Count({<Date={'>=$(vRolling45_2)<=$(vMaxim_2)'}>} Distinct SerialNo)
Count({<Date={'>=$(vRolling45_3)<=$(vMaxim_3)'}>} Distinct SerialNo)
But I don't want to create these many variable, Can someone help me out to achieve this in any other way
Problem 2:
Now I want to show this on bar chart where my dimension will be dates of the current month
value for maximum date(15-12-2017)
Count({<Date={'>=$(vRolling45)<=$(vMaxim)'}>} Distinct SerialNo) // Stock as on date from last 45 days
Value obtained from following expression on maximum date -1(14-12-2017)
Count({<Date={'>=$(vRolling45_1)<=$(vMaxim_1)'}>} Distinct SerialNo) //Stock as on previous date from its last 45 days
and so on for the running month...
How can I achieve this?
